     A great friend of mine and I decided to meet for lunch one day. See, we used to work together and then he retired but every year when the Greek Church would have their annual Greek Food Festival he would get so excited and buy multiple orders of Pastitsio. Every time I would pass Mediterrano, located off of Babcock Boulevard, I knew that we had to go there.

     It was a Thursday afternoon around 3:00pm so in between lunch and dinner; there were the two of us and one other table. It was very cute and quiet and the atmosphere was awesome. Another perk, it's BYOB!! Its perfect for a great little date night spot; a bottle of wine, great food and a romantic atmosphere.

     Anyway, to the food! He knew right away what he was going to order but I looked over the the menu and decided to order the same, except I got rice as my side and he ordered the Greek fries. For dinner, you get two sides. The pastitsio was luscious and buttery. When you cut it with a fork, the béchamel sauce just oozed out. It was rich and just sooo good! The rice was perfectly cooked and was a great accompaniment. Don't count out the fries though. They were amazing! Feta cheese and oregano on the warm fries was delicious. It was a hearty helping that would not let you go hungry. If you have a day of just relaxation, it is perfect for lunch but make sure you take a good bottle of wine to complete the dish! The menu is priced just right for your wallets and will leave you satisifed with possible left overs.

     I love Greek Food Festivals, but for fresh, made to order authentic Mediterranean food, Check out Mediterrano! Let me know what you think.
